West junior raising funds for the Polar Bear Plunge
By Natalie Wanasek, Current Staff
For most people, winter is a time for cozy blankets, hot chocolate, and making snowmen. However, the one thing West junior Brogan Zochert is looking forward to this February is the chance to jump into sub-zero water.
While this may sound a bit out there, Brogan’s desire to do so is well-founded. She, along with 6 other WBHS students, are going to take the Polar Bear Plunge on February 15 to help raise money for the 2014 Special Olympics. This annual event has been a part of Wisconsin culture since the early 1900s, and also takes place in Canada, the United Kingdom, and the Netherlands. Continue reading
